Yixlid Jailer

Creature — Zombie Wizard


Cards in graveyards lose all abilities.

"I have an eternity to know the souls who are bound here, to behold their every facet. But moments from now they will be gagged and masked, and they shall be known by none other."

Rulings

  • 2007-05-01
    If Mistform Ultimus is in the graveyard, the Ultimus will lose its ability that says “Mistform Ultimus is every creature type,” but it will still *be* all creature types. The way continuous effects work, Mistform Ultimus’s type-changing ability is applied before Yixlid Jailer’s ability removes it.
  • 2007-05-01
    Some cards have abilities that modify how they’re put onto the battlefield. For example, Scarwood Treefolk says “Scarwood Treefolk is put onto the battlefield tapped” and Triskelion says “Triskelion enters the battlefield with three +1/+1 counters on it.” Although these cards won’t have these abilities in the graveyard, they will be applied if the cards are put onto the battlefield from the graveyard (due to Zombify, perhaps). What matters is that these cards will have these abilities on the battlefield.
  • 2007-05-01
    Some replacement effects cause a card to be put somewhere else instead of being put into a graveyard (such as Legacy Weapon). These effects mean the card is never actually put into the graveyard, so Yixlid Jailer can’t affect it.
  • 2007-05-01
    If an ability triggers when the object that has it is put into a hidden zone from a graveyard, that ability triggers from the graveyard, (such as Golgari Brownscale), Yixlid Jailer will prevent that ability from triggering.
  • 2007-05-01
    If an ability triggers when the object that has it is put into a graveyard from anywhere other than the battlefield, that ability triggers from the graveyard, (such as Krosan Tusker, Narcomoeba, or Quagnoth, for example). Yixlid Jailer will prevent those abilities from triggering at all.
  • 2007-05-01
    If an ability triggers when the object that has it is put into a graveyard from the battlefield, that ability triggers from the battlefield (such as Deadwood Treefolk or Epochrasite, for example), they won’t be affected by Yixlid Jailer.
  • 2007-05-01
    This removes all abilities on all cards in all graveyards — both the ones that matter in a graveyard (dredge, Chronosavant’s ability, etc.) and those that don’t.
  • 2021-03-19
    Some cards have abilities that apply “as [this card] enters the battlefield” or state that “[this card] enters the battlefield with” counters. Although these cards won’t have these abilities in the graveyard, they will be applied if the cards are put onto the battlefield from the graveyard (due to Zombify, perhaps). What matters is that these cards will have these abilities on the battlefield.
  • 2021-03-19
    If an ability triggers when the object that has it is put into a graveyard from the battlefield, that ability triggers from the battlefield and isn’t affected by Yixlid Jailer.
  • 2021-03-19
    If an ability triggers when the object that has it is put into a graveyard from anywhere other than the battlefield, such as Krosan Tusker or Narcomoeba, that ability triggers from the graveyard. Yixlid Jailer stops those abilities from triggering at all. This includes abilities that trigger when a card is put into a graveyard “from anywhere,” even if that card was on the battlefield.
  • 2021-03-19
    If a spell or ability allows you to cast a spell from your graveyard, the first step in doing so is to move it to the stack. That spell’s additional and alternative costs may be applied. However, if a card’s own ability allows you to cast it from your graveyard (such as a flashback ability) Yixlid Jailer stops that ability.
  • 2021-03-19
    If a card in a graveyard has an ability that defines a * in its power or toughness, that * is 0. For example, Tarmogoyf is a 0/1 creature card in your graveyard while you control Yixlid Jailer.
  • 2021-03-19
    If a card with changeling is in a graveyard, it still has all creature types.
  • 2021-03-19
    Some replacement effects cause a card to be put somewhere else instead of being put into a graveyard (such as that of Darksteel Colossus). These effects mean the card is never actually put into the graveyard, so Yixlid Jailer doesn’t affect that ability.
